Election results for Bradford East
Parliamentary elections - Thursday, 8th June, 2017
Status:
Published
Parliamentary elections - results by party
Previous results for Bradford East
Summary of comparison with previous results for Bradford East
Bradford East - results
Election Candidate
Party
Votes
%
Outcome
Imran Hussain
Labour
29831
65%
Elected
Mark Russell Trafford
Conservative
9291
20%
Not elected
David Ward
Independent
3576
8%
Not elected
Jonathan Daniel Stewart Barras
United Kingdom Independence Party
1372
3%
Not elected
Mark George Jewell
Liberal Democrat and independent
843
2%
Not elected
Paul Graeme Parkins
Better for Bradford
420
1%
Not elected
Andy Stanford
Green Party
289
1%
Not elected
Voting Summary
Details
Number
Seats
1
Total votes
45622
Electorate
70389
Number of ballot papers issued
45700
Number of ballot papers rejected
78
Turnout
65%
